Transaction 5621494edd9ba333af65ec2931616d51e6ea859753ed36d8cb5cf8692499bb45
1 Input
1 Output
-
5621494edd9ba333af65ec2931616d51e6ea859753ed36d8cb5cf8692499bb45:0
- value
- 340756
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6b6ac0e56ccc8128388e63e5df4677f59499786
- address
- bc1q66m2crjkenyp9qugucl9mar80av5n9uxgn7nqy